Wellman, Texas, with a city population of 252 and located inside a metro area population of 2.5+ million, sits in a steady-growth environment where a growth rate of 0.70% annually supports continual home improvements and modest new construction. That steady pace means demand for renovations, driveways, landscaping refreshes, and small commercial jobs remains consistent rather than cyclical. Local climate and geography — including 228 sunny days per year and an annual rainfall of 34.80 inches — create a mix of strong solar exposure and occasional significant rain events; homeowners therefore look for materials that manage both UV stress and stormwater. Reliable bulk supplies like sand, dirt, gravel, mulch, and blended aggregates help control erosion, improve drainage, suppress dust, and establish plantings with lower long-term maintenance, so material performance and timely delivery matter as much as price. Wellman’s growing conditions and hardiness zone of 8b influence how materials perform: soils and surface materials must retain moisture during hot, sunny stretches yet shed water quickly during rain to avoid pooling and erosion. This means choosing materials with the right gradation and organic content for beds and topsoil, selecting stable base mixes for driveways and walkways, and using erosion-control aggregates where slopes or runoff are present. For homeowners, that translates into practical decisions about drainage, compaction, and seasonal timing. Homeowners and contractors in Wellman typically use a mix of materials like gravel, sand, dirt, and stone for driveways, walkways, patios, grading, and garden beds. Regional suppliers mean color and texture can vary, so consider both performance and appearance when choosing materials. Ask about local examples to see how materials hold up in West Texas conditions.
Match the material to the job: think about load, drainage, and how much maintenance you want. For example, projects that need drainage prefer coarser, free-draining materials, while finished patios may need a finer base and a topping that matches your look. Consider local availability and talk with suppliers about regional performance in West Texas.
Measure the length, width, and depth of the area and use a material calculator to convert cubic feet to cubic yards or tons. Access can be a challenge in rural areas: narrow roads, low-hanging wires, short turnarounds, soft shoulders, and weight restrictions all matter. Note any access issues in the checkout notes and consider sending photos to customer service so the hauler can plan. Drivers will assess safety on arrival and may request a different drop location if needed.
Hot, dry summers and occasional heavy rains influence how materials perform: heat and sun can cause fine materials to blow or compact, while intense storms can cause erosion or washouts. Choose materials and installation methods that handle both drought and episodic heavy rain, and plan for periodic topping or regrading after extreme weather. Regional suppliers can advise which mixes perform best locally.
Spring and fall are often the most comfortable and predictable for outdoor work in West Texas, with milder temperatures and lower chance of extreme heat. Avoid scheduling large earth-moving or surfacing jobs during the hottest summer days or immediately before the rainy season to minimize delays and material handling issues. Regulations vary by county and any neighborhood HOA, so check with Terry County or your HOA before you begin work. Simple changes like adding topsoil or decorative stone often have fewer restrictions, but building a new driveway, adding hardscape, or changing drainage can trigger permit requirements. When in doubt, contact local authorities or your contractor to confirm rules before ordering materials.
Common issues include water runoff down slopes, concentrated flow points, and erosion after heavy storms. Plan for proper grading, use of drainage channels or rock-lined swales, and stable base layers to reduce washouts. Selecting the right combination of gravel, sand, dirt, and stone and placing them correctly is more important than the exact product brand.
Most people weigh cost, durability, maintenance, appearance, and local availability when choosing materials. Ask for local examples and performance histories, factor in long-term upkeep costs, and consider how easy it will be to get matching materials in the future because regional sourcing causes variation. The material will be delivered via dump truck. If your order is under 20 tons, then it will likely be just one dump truck load. If your order is more than 20 tons, it will be more than one dump truck load.
Absolutely! Try our aggregate quiz here: https://hellogravel.com/aggregate-quiz/ Alternatively,you can call us, chat with us (box in the bottom right corner of the website), or email us!
We cannot get out of the truck and manually spread it. However, depending on the location, safety, and comfortability of the driver – we may be able to tailgate spread your material. This involves pulling the truck forward as material is being dumped to make it easier for you to distribute material after delivery.
